Aim: This paper uncover the existing problems and common reasons of Business Process Reengineering (BPR) and research the effect of BPR in the Quality Control of Signal Sickness by analyzing the present business process. The aim of the paper is intend to provide some specific methods for the hospital administrator to cany on quality control of single sickness. Method: Firstly, sampling 30 anainnesis on cholecy stitis, chdelithiasis, and myoma of uterus operation of a National grade a hospital in the year 2000, then checking 9 steps from the patients inand out the hospitaland studying the changes of dates the patients to be in charge, the fees the patients spentand the curative effect in every steps beforeandafter BPR. and finally a statistical analysis was carving out. Result: (1 )The average dates the patients staved in the hospital have shortened. Greatly after I3PR, It decreas from 14.22 days to 12.42 days and makes 1.80 days savings(P<0.00 1). The average dates the patients staved in the hospital for breast cancer, myoma of uterus and cholecvstitis cholelithiasis operation have decreased 2.3 days. 1.5 dave and 1.60 days respectively. And there exist unnecessary dates in all the three operation processes before and after operation. (2) The average fees the patients spentin the hospital after BPR have decrease 158.10 yuan, from 5096.41 yuan to 4938.31 yuan.
